如何使用mysql命令行导入数据库
概述
在开发中,有时候我们需要将一个数据库的备份文件导入到mysql数据库中,这时候我们可以使用mysql命令行来完成这个任务。下面我将向你介绍如何使用mysql命令行来导入数据库。
导入数据库流程
journey
title 导入数据库流程
section 开始
开始 --> 检查数据库文件是否存在
section 检查数据库文件是否存在
检查数据库文件是否存在 --> 创建数据库
section 创建数据库
创建数据库 --> 导入数据
section 导入数据
导入数据 --> 完成
section 完成
步骤说明
步骤 | 说明 |
---|---|
1 | 检查数据库文件是否存在 |
2 | 创建数据库 |
3 | 导入数据 |
4 | 完成 |
具体步骤及代码
-
检查数据库文件是否存在
- 使用以下命令检查数据库文件是否存在:
ls /path/to/your/database/file.sql
- 如果文件存在,继续下一步;如果文件不存在,请检查文件路径是否正确。
-
创建数据库
- 使用以下命令在mysql中创建新的数据库:
mysql -u your_username -p
- 输入密码后,使用以下命令创建数据库:
CREATE DATABASE your_database_name;
-
导入数据
- 使用以下命令导入数据库文件到新创建的数据库中:
mysql -u your_username -p your_database_name < /path/to/your/database/file.sql
- 输入密码后,等待导入完成。
-
完成
- 导入完成后,你可以使用以下命令查看导入的数据是否正确:
mysql -u your_username -p your_database_name
- 进入mysql后,使用以下查询查看数据是否成功导入:
SHOW TABLES;
通过以上步骤,你就成功地使用mysql命令行导入了数据库。如果有任何问题,请随时向我咨询。祝你学习顺利!